Figure 2 in Palaeobiology of tanaidaceans (Crustacea: Peracarida) from Cretaceous ambers: extending the scarce fossil record of a diverse peracarid group
Figure 2. Male holotype and paratypes of Eurotanais pyrenaensis sp. nov. A, photograph of the entire piece MNHN.F.A51529; from left to right white arrows point to the paratype (MNHN.F.A51529b), holotype (MNHN.F.A51529a), and paratype (MNHN.F.A51529c); B, camera lucida drawing of the holotype in ventrolateral habitus; C, ventrolateral habitus of the same specimen; D, right pereopods 1–3 showing ischia (asterisks); E, detail of left cheliped. Scale bars: A = 1 mm; B, C = 0.2 mm; D, E = 0.1 mm.
